Guido Schneider is a scholar working on Statistical and Nonlinear Physics, Computer Networks and Communications and Mathematical Physics. According to data from OpenAlex, Guido Schneider has authored 139 papers receiving a total of 2.1k indexed citations (citations by other indexed papers that have themselves been cited), including 76 papers in Statistical and Nonlinear Physics, 50 papers in Computer Networks and Communications and 40 papers in Mathematical Physics. Recurrent topics in Guido Schneider's work include Nonlinear Photonic Systems (58 papers), Nonlinear Dynamics and Pattern Formation (50 papers) and Advanced Mathematical Physics Problems (39 papers). Guido Schneider is often cited by papers focused on Nonlinear Photonic Systems (58 papers), Nonlinear Dynamics and Pattern Formation (50 papers) and Advanced Mathematical Physics Problems (39 papers). Guido Schneider collaborates with scholars based in Germany, United States and Canada. Guido Schneider's co-authors include C. Eugene Wayne, Alexander Mielke, Hannes Uecker, Dmitry E. Pelinovsky, Björn Sandstede, Arnd Scheel, Arjen Doelman, Christopher Chong, M. D. Groves and Thierry Gallay and has published in prestigious journals such as SHILAP Revista de lepidopterología, Water Resources Research and IEEE Transactions on Antennas and Propagation.
